Daniel Holt was a young man, who in his short time, made a positive impact on hundreds of people. This became evident during his courageous battle against an aggressive, rare (non-smoker) form of lung cancer. It was ultimately realized when more than 700 people came to his funeral service to pay their respect.
Danny was always admired by his peers, and looked up to by the children he cared for. He was a talented athlete, earning the captain’s badge for the Danbury High School varsity football team. He was a talented artist, known best for his crooning, who sang with a local music group. He was a youth athletics coach, a camp counselor, and student aid. His calling was caring, he invested everything in this calling, and he always did it with his heart on his sleeve and a smile on his face.
His family has established the Holt Foundation, with a memorial fund that distributes raised money to various charities including the Hord Scholarship Foundation, the “I’m Too Young For This” Cancer Foundation, the Danbury Athletic Youth Organization, and the Brookfield Y.M.C.A. Day Camp.
Danny Holt’s contribution to his community, and the energy and love he put into everything he did will not be forgotten. His family and community will ensure that his name and his calling live on.
